What is a webinar?
A webinar is a live online session where a presenter teaches, explains a topic, and interacts with an audience through webinar software. It feels similar to a college lecture, only everything happens online. People can join from home, the office, or anywhere with a stable internet connection. During a webinar, the presenter can share slides, walk through demos, show videos, answer questions, and communicate with attendees in real time. Many webinars also include polls, chat, Q&A, and other interactive tools that help keep the audience engaged.

The word “webinar” started appearing on the internet in the late 1990s, around 1997 to 1998, and it has kept the same meaning ever since. From the beginning, it described an online event where a host leads a presentation, guides a group through a subject, and talks to participants live over the internet, you can explore our detailed webinar history guide.

Is a webinar like Zoom?
The short answer is that Zoom is mainly designed for online meetings. Its entire experience is built around a meeting-style format where several people join the call, talk to each other, use a shared whiteboard if they want, and then end the session.

A webinar platform works in a different way because it is created specifically for hosting webinars. This means the event follows a lecture-style structure. One presenter leads the session the same way a college instructor guides a class. The presenter shares materials, draws on the whiteboard, shows content, and finishes the event with a question-and-answer session. This format works especially well when you need to teach, train, or present information to a large audience.
